Russia might put strategic nukes in Belarus, leader says

Por: The Boston Globe World April 01, 2023

thumbnail

TALLINN, Estonia — Russian strategic nuclear weapons might be deployed to Belarus along with part of Russia’s tactical nuclear arsenal, Belarusian President Alexander Lukashenko said Friday, ramping up his rhetoric amid tensions with the West over the Kremlin’s war in Ukraine.Russian President Vladimir Putin announced last week that his country plans to deploy tactical, comparatively short-range, and small-yield nuclear weapons in... + full article
